A pilot program is a small-scale, exploratory venture intended to test the viability of a project or policy. TLC uses pilot programs to decide whether or not a proposed policy will improve safety, customer service, and agency operations.. Current Pilots. GREEN Green taxis, also known as boro taxis and street-hail liveries, were introduced in ...Your Ride. TLC licenses over 130,000 vehicles in New York City. Each vehicle receives comprehensive safety and emissions inspections by TLC and must be driven by TLC-licensed drivers that have undergone background checks and passed TLC education requirements. Learn about the differences in the types of TLC-licensed vehicles as well … TLC Driver License. Please note: Effective June 1st, 2023, drug testing fee will increase from $32.00 to $34.00. The TLC Driver License is a single license that lets you drive a yellow taxi, green taxi, livery, black car, and limousine. Most drivers get this license, unless they know they are going to drive a commuter van or paratransit vehicle. At Commission Meetings, TLC's Commissioners vote to approve or deny changes to for-hire base licenses, hear public testimony on proposed changes to TLC rules and vote on proposed rules and pilot programs. Anyone who wants to comment on the proposed rule at the Beginning May 16, 2023 at 10am, TLC licensed drivers may apply for an SHL Pilot Program Permit and the associated For-Hire Vehicle License. These vehicles, distinguished by “P” markings, will test the viability of a license that cuts the costs of operating an SHL, while also eliminating the ability to receive street hails. Additionally, all New York City Taxi and Limousine Commission licensed taxi drivers must have a map available to them when on duty. If they do not, they are in violation of TLC rules and regulations. In addition, as per TLC rules, they are required to know the "lay of the land", that is, have extensive knowledge of the NYC area.
